CHARACTERIZATION OF POLY(m-PHENYLENE SULFIDE) AND POLY(p-PHENYLENE SULFIDE)
Yang Wenbin,Xie Meiju,Yu Zili,Yan Yonggang,Chen Yongrong,Wu Qixain.CHARACTERIZATION OF POLY(m-PHENYLENE SULFIDE) AND POLY(p-PHENYLENE SULFIDE)[J].Chemical Research and Application,1999,11(4):406-408.
Authors:Yang Wenbin  Xie Meiju  Yu Zili  Yan Yonggang  Chen Yongrong  Wu Qixain
Abstract:Poly(p phenylene sulfide)(p PPS) and poly (m phenylene sulfide)(m PPS) were synthesized from sodium sulfide (Na 2S), p dichlorobenzene(p DCB) and m dichlorobenzene (m DCB) in hexamethylphosphoric triamide (HMPA).Both m PPS and p PPS were characterized by elemental analysis,infrared spectroscopy,X ray diffraction and thermal analysis.The results showed that m PPS and p PPS were crystalline polymers with different crystalline structures.Tg,Tm and thermal stability of m PPS were lower than those of p PPS.
Keywords:poly(p  phenylene sulfide)  poly(m  phenylene sulfide)  characterization
